What is the difference between Assistant Quant Trading vs Quant Trader?
| Aspect | Assistant Quant Trading | Quant Trader |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ree in finance, mathematics, or related field; some roles may require a master's | Advanced degrees (Master's or PhD) often preferred; strong programming and quantitative skills |
| Work Environment | Supportive, team-based, often in financial firms or hedge funds | High-pressure, independent decision-making, trading desks or proprietary trading firms |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Common in financial institutions, hedge funds, asset management firms | Primarily in hedge funds, proprietary trading firms, investment banks |
Assistant Quant Trading roles typically involve supporting quantitative trading teams with research, data analysis, and model testing, often requiring less experience and focusing on learning and assisting. Quant Traders are responsible for developing and executing trading strategies, making independent decisions, and managing risk, requiring advanced skills and experience. Both roles are integral to quantitative finance but differ mainly in responsibility level and independence.

Location: Nicholasville, KY (Travel required up to 70%)
Position Summary: The Field Application Scientist (FAS) will serve as the primary technical liaison between Client and its customers. The role requires in-depth expertise in qPCR technology, excellent communication skills, and the ability to provide pre- and post-sales technical support. This role involves significant travel to customer sites, trade shows, and conferences.
Key Responsibilities:
Technical Expertise:
- Provide expert knowledge on qPCR technology and Client's product offerings to customers.
- Assist customers with experimental design, optimization, and troubleshooting of qPCR assays.
- Deliver technical presentations and demonstrations of qPCR solutions to customers.
- Offer guidance on CLIA, COLA, and CAP validation processes and regulatory compliance.
- Act as a technical resource for pre-and post-sales activities to support the sales team.
- Provide hands-on training and support for qPCR workflows and protocols.
- Collect Voice-of-Customer (VOC) feedback and relay insights to Product Management and R&D teams.
Collaborative Efforts:
- Partner with the sales team to identify and nurture new business opportunities.
- Support cross-functional teams in technical discussions, project management, and product development.
- Liaise with internal teams to address customer requirements and ensure satisfaction.
Market Development:
- Attend trade shows, industry seminars, and conferences to promote Client products.
- Stay informed of market trends, competitor products, and industry innovations.
- Bachelor's degree in molecular biology, Biochemistry, Genetics, or a related field (Master's or PhD preferred).
- At least 4 years of hands-on laboratory experience, including qPCR techniques.
- Strong theoretical and practical background in molecular biology.
- Experience with CLIA and CAP regulatory validations.
- Proficiency in technical report writing and data analysis.
- Familiarity with automated systems and laboratory instruments.
- High-level pro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, PowerPoint).
- Excellent communication, organizational, and troubleshooting skills.
- Ability to travel domestically up to 70%.
- Valid driver's license.
- Candidates must be based in Lexington, KY, or the surrounding area and able to commute to the office when not traveling.
- Experience in real-time PCR instruments, such as (Quant studio and Bio-Rad), and advanced data interpretation.
- Familiarity with DNA/RNA extraction workflows.
- Training or education skills to support diverse audiences.
- Ability to work independently and adapt to a fast-paced environment.
